Why Stopping at the Sticker Price for Hitachi Equipment Is Missing the Point
Here's my view, plain and simple: If you're buying a 450 Hitachi excavator or sourcing Hitachi planer parts based on the cheapest list price, you're probably costing your company more money in the long run. I've seen it happen too many times in my six years of managing procurement budgets, and I've made the mistake myself.
I'm a procurement manager for a mid-sized construction firm. I've managed a parts and equipment budget of roughly $180,000 annually for over half a decade, negotiated with dozens of suppliers, and tracked every single invoice in our cost tracking system. So when I say the lowest price is a trap, it's not a theory—it's an observation from a stack of POs and a few hard lessons.

Let's talk about Hitachi planer parts. A few years ago, we needed a set of teeth for a cold planer attachment. Vendor A quoted us $1,800. Vendor B quoted $1,400. My gut said go with B—saving $400 is saving $400, right?
Well, I almost went with B until I calculated the total cost. Vendor B charged $150 for shipping, required a minimum order of $500, and their 'compatible' parts had a 30% failure rate in the first 90 days based on customer reviews I dug up. Vendor A's $1,800 included free shipping, no minimum, and OEM-grade parts with a warranty. When I added it all up, Vendor B's $1,400 quote would have cost us nearly $2,200 after replacements and downtime. That's a 22% premium hidden in fine print and poor quality.
I still kick myself for almost falling for that. That $400 'savings' would have been a $400 loss.

When you're looking for a straight truck or a piece of heavy equipment, the conversation often boils down to price and specs. But for a contractor, time is money. A machine sitting idle—whether it's a 450 Hitachi excavator or a straight truck—costs you billable hours.
In Q3 2024, we sourced a final drive motor for a 450 Hitachi excavator. The cheapest supplier was 15% under market, but they had a 4-week lead time. The Hitachi dealer had it in stock, ready to ship. The dealer's price was higher by about $800. But the downtime cost? Our excavator was worth $850 a day in revenue. Waiting 4 weeks for the cheap part would have cost us $17,000 in lost work. The 'expensive' part from the dealer saved us $16,200.
This gets into logistics and inventory management territory, which isn't my deep expertise. What I can tell you from a procurement perspective is: availability and speed are part of the price. Don't ignore them.

I have mixed feelings about the aftermarket parts market. On one hand, competition drives prices down, which is good. On the other hand, cheap parts often create a rabbit hole of recurring issues. You buy a cheap hydraulic cylinder rebuild kit for a Hitachi excavator. It fails in 3 months. You replace it. It fails again. Then you're buying the OEM part anyway, but you've also paid for labor twice and lost a week of operation.
To be fair, not all aftermarket parts are bad. But I've learned to apply the 'crane fly vs. mosquito' test to my decisions: some cost issues are huge and obvious (like a broken engine), while others are small but persistent (like a leaky seal). The cheap option often turns a mosquito problem into a crane fly problem—it gets bigger and harder to swat.
I wish I had tracked our 'rework costs' more carefully from the start of my career. What I can say anecdotally is that the $200 we saved on a cheap part cost us $1,500 in labor and expedited shipping when it failed during a critical job.
Rebutting the Obvious Concern: 'But My Budget Is Tight'
I get it. Budgets are real. The numbers said go with the lowest price—my spreadsheets often point to that option. My gut sometimes says something feels off. The data isn't always clean. But in my experience, 'I can't afford the better option' is often a symptom of not calculating the total cost of ownership.
Granted, calculating TCO takes more upfront work. It requires getting quotes from multiple vendors, checking lead times, and factoring in downtime. But that 'free setup' or 'low price' from a vendor can cost you $450 more in hidden fees, just like I learned with that late fee on a cheap freight quote.
Switching to a value-over-price strategy saved our firm about $8,400 annually—roughly 17% of our procurement budget—once we accounted for fewer re-orders and less downtime. That's not a theory; that's a number from our year-end review.
So here's my final take: Stop optimizing for the sticker price. Start optimizing for total cost. Whether you're buying a 450 Hitachi excavator, straight truck parts, or anything in between, the cheapest choice is rarely the best investment. That's my opinion, and I'm sticking to it based on 6 years of data, a few regrets, and a lot of saved receipts.
